Another way to do it is to set FCH_RESET_DATA_BLOCK->LegacyFree to 0 in
board_FCH_InitReset(), if HAS_AGESA_FCH_OEM_CALLOUT is enabled. That way
one can debug AGESA state machine without a gap in the output.
I'm not strongly opposed to this approach, just leaving this comment as
another option.
